Output 0e28987cedb75872e76824da91f30ccd0e588dfcd0eb85fa571066972d08eed9:56

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59bfca66b3feae8904b2f3137b6c2d7bdd2a0a2a60d95e843880108cf84b16b6
address
bc1ptxlu5e4nl6hgjp9j7vfhkmpd00wj5z32vrv4appcsqgge7ztz6mqut3u8k
transaction
0e28987cedb75872e76824da91f30ccd0e588dfcd0eb85fa571066972d08eed9
spent
true